Take ownership of projects from concept development to final delivery What you will do
Lead the vision
Translate client briefs into clear event concepts and strategic direction.
Structure projects from the beginning: timelines, milestones, workflows, and operational plans that allow teams to execute with precision.
Guide the creation of proposals and presentations that help win clients and build long-term partnerships.
Shape the project
Oversee the full lifecycle of corporate events, conventions, and incentive programs.
Select and manage suppliers, venues, and production partners.
Lead negotiations and supervise budgeting, estimates, and financial planning, ensuring every project is both creative and commercially sustainable.
Drive execution
Coordinate external partners to ensure every component is aligned.
Maintain oversight of logistics, technical production, travel arrangements, and operational planning.
Be present onsite when needed, ensuring the event runs smoothly and decisions are made quickly and effectively.
Own the result
Ensure every project closes with clear reporting, cost reconciliation, and margin analysis.
Evaluate results and identify opportunities for improvement and future projects.
